Biodegradable packaging is designed to break down naturally in specific environmental conditions, reducing waste and pollution. Unlike traditional plastic, which can persist for hundreds of years, biodegradable materials can decompose into organic matter, potentially transforming into beneficial compost. This vital difference positions biodegradable packaging as a promising alternative within sustainability efforts across various industries.
Biodegradable packaging manufacturers are at the forefront of this change, innovating products that cater to both consumer preferences and environmental standards. These manufacturers utilize a range of materials, including plant-based polymers, which not only diminish reliance on fossil fuels but also reduce carbon footprints during production. However, the effectiveness of their offerings in achieving true sustainability is a subject of scrutiny.
When evaluating whether biodegradable packaging manufacturers are meeting sustainability needs, several key metrics come into play:
Material Sourcing: Are the raw materials sustainably sourced? Ethical sourcing can greatly enhance the overall environmental impact of packaging solutions.
Production Processes: What energy sources are used in manufacturing? The sustainability of biodegradable packaging is contingent not just on the end product, but also on the energy consumed during its production.
Decomposition Conditions: Not all biodegradable materials decompose under the same conditions. Many require industrial composting facilities that are often unavailable, leading to questions about their real-world effectiveness.

End-of-Life Solutions: Do these manufacturers provide clear guidelines on how to dispose of their products sustainably? Consumer education is vital for ensuring that biodegradable packaging fulfills its intended purpose.
Consumer awareness regarding biodegradable options is crucial. Many individuals misinterpret the term "biodegradable," and without proper education, they may unknowingly contribute to landfill waste due to a lack of understanding on how to dispose of these materials. Therefore, manufacturers have a responsibility to provide transparency about their products’ compostability and breakdown timelines.
Implementing clear labeling and education initiatives can empower consumers to make informed choices, fostering a more significant impact on sustainability efforts.
While significant strides have been made, biodegradable packaging manufacturers still face challenges, including the need for innovation in material technology and production efficiency. Continuous research and development are essential to create packaging that not only meets consumer demands but also adheres to environmental regulations and standards.
Emerging innovations, such as the development of bio-based plastics and advancements in composting technologies, promise to enhance the effectiveness of biodegradable solutions. Manufacturers must invest in such innovations to stay relevant and continue pushing sustainability forward.
